Frequently asked questions

How often do Belgium and Cyprus vote together at the UN?

Belgium and Cyprus voted the same way in 60.3% of 5,380 shared UN General Assembly votes since 1946.

Do Belgium and Cyprus agree on human rights votes?

On human rights resolutions, Belgium and Cyprus are split: they voted the same way in 60.6% of 956 shared human-rights votes at the UN General Assembly.

When did Belgium and Cyprus last disagree at the UN?

Among their biggest recent splits, on 2017-12-04 Belgium voted "no" and Cyprus voted "yes" on A/RES/72/31 (Taking forward multilateral nuclear disarmament negotiations : resolution / adopted by the General Assembly).

Data source: Erik Voeten et al., 'United Nations General Assembly Voting Data', Harvard Dataverse.
